What Is Citizenship by Investment?
Citizenship by Investment (CBI) is a legal process that allows individuals and their families to obtain citizenship and a passport from a country by making a significant economic contribution. This contribution typically takes the form of a donation to a government fund, a real estate investment, or a business investment.
Unlike traditional immigration pathways that require years of residency, language tests, and cultural integration, CBI programs offer a streamlined route to a second nationality — often within 3 to 6 months.
Why Do People Seek a Second Citizenship?
There are several compelling reasons why high-net-worth individuals and families pursue a second passport:
Global Mobility: A second passport can dramatically increase your visa-free travel access. Caribbean passports, for example, provide visa-free or visa-on-arrival access to 140+ countries.
Asset Protection: Diversifying your citizenship portfolio helps protect your wealth and assets across multiple jurisdictions, reducing exposure to political or economic instability in any single country.
Business Expansion: A second citizenship can open doors to new markets, banking relationships, and business opportunities in regions that may be difficult to access with your current passport.
Family Security: CBI programs typically include spouse, children, and sometimes parents and grandparents, providing the entire family with a safety net and enhanced global mobility.
Tax Planning: Some CBI countries offer favorable tax regimes with no income tax, capital gains tax, or wealth tax, enabling legitimate tax optimization strategies.
Available CBI Programs in 2026
Caribbean Programs
The Caribbean region hosts the most established and popular CBI programs in the world:
Dominica: Known as the "Nature Isle of the Caribbean," Dominica offers one of the most affordable CBI programs starting from $100,000 for a single applicant through the Economic Diversification Fund (EDF). Processing typically takes 3-4 months.
St. Kitts & Nevis: The world's oldest CBI program (established 1984) offers citizenship through a contribution to the Sustainable Island State Contribution (SISC) fund or real estate investment. The program is known for its strong due diligence and respected passport.
Grenada: Unique among Caribbean programs, Grenada's CBI includes access to the US E-2 Treaty Investor Visa, making it particularly attractive for those seeking a pathway to live and work in the United States.
St. Lucia: Offers competitive pricing and multiple investment options including a National Economic Fund contribution, real estate, government bonds, or enterprise projects.
Antigua & Barbuda: Requires a brief 5-day visit within the first 5 years of citizenship. Offers contribution and real estate investment routes with processing in 3-6 months.
European Golden Visa Programs
For those seeking European residency with a path to EU citizenship:
Greece Golden Visa: Real estate investment from €250,000 grants a 5-year renewable residency with Schengen zone access. Path to citizenship after 7 years.
Portugal Golden Visa: Through investment fund options (minimum €500,000), gain residency with the fastest path to EU citizenship — just 5 years with minimal stay requirements (7 days per year).
Spain Golden Visa: Real estate investment from €500,000 provides residency with Schengen access. Path to citizenship after 10 years.
How to Choose the Right Program
When selecting a CBI program, consider these key factors:
- Budget: Programs range from $100,000 to €500,000+. Determine your investment capacity.
- Travel Needs: Compare visa-free access for each passport against your travel requirements.
- Timeline: If speed is critical, Caribbean programs (3-6 months) are faster than European programs.
- Family Size: Some programs offer better value for larger families.
- Long-term Goals: If EU citizenship is the goal, European Golden Visas provide a clear pathway.
